Palestine calls for int'l sanctions on Israel for demolishing Palestinians' homes

RAMALLAH, Nov. 7 (Xinhua) -- Palestine on Saturday urged the international community to impose sanctions on Israel for its policy of demolishing Palestinians' homes.

Israel demolished Palestinians' homes and structures in the Jordan Valley in the West Bank and left 73 Palestinian citizens homeless, the Palestinian Ministry of Foreign Affairs said in a press statement sent to Xinhua.

"It's an awful complex crime that violates the international law, Geneva Conventions, and human rights principles," the ministry said.

Demolishing Palestinians' homes and structures "reflects the extent of the expansion of settlements targeting the Palestinian Jordan Valley," it added.

Meanwhile, Hazem Qassem, spokesman of Gaza's ruling party Hamas, said Hamas calls for reactivating the popular resistance "to confront the Israeli policies against the Palestinians." Enditem
